汽车租赁系统:数据库模块详解与UML实例

需积分: 34 219 下载量 187 浏览量 更新于2024-08-20 收藏 397KB PPT 举报
在本文档中,主要讨论的是关于汽车租赁系统的数据库模块及其在UML(统一建模语言)中的应用实例。首先,系统需求分析部分明确了几个关键功能,包括客户预订车辆、信息保存、员工管理和服务记录等。以下是数据库模块的详细内容: 1. 数据库模块功能: - 客户信息管理:这一模块不仅涵盖了客户的基本信息,如姓名、联系方式等,还包括了客户的租赁历史记录,以便于了解客户的租赁习惯和偏好,有助于提供个性化的服务。 - 车辆信息管理:车辆信息包括车辆的具体型号、车牌号、车辆的新旧程度以及车辆当前的状态(例如:预留、出租或空闲),这对于租赁公司来说至关重要,可以帮助他们快速定位可用的车辆并进行有效调度。 - 租赁信息管理:记录了客户的租赁申请表,便于跟踪租赁流程和确保及时处理,同时技术人员的服务记录也纳入其中,反映了车辆的维修和保养情况。 - 员工信息管理:存储了公司员工的个人信息,包括基本信息和工作表现数据,如任务完成率,便于管理人员评估员工绩效和进行培训。 整个数据库模块的设计基于UML建模,这意味着在设计过程中可能涉及实体关系图(ERD)、类图、序列图或活动图等工具,用于描绘数据结构、交互流程和系统组件之间的关系。通过这些模型,开发团队可以更好地理解和规划系统架构,确保各个模块间的高效协作。 此外,文档还提到了其他模块,如基本数据维护模块负责添加、修改车辆和员工信息,而基本业务模块则处理用户预订、工作人员处理请求、服务记录填写和还车操作。信息查询模块则支持对各种信息的检索,如客户、员工、车辆和租赁记录的查找。 这个数据库模块是汽车租赁系统的核心部分,通过集成所有必要的数据管理和业务逻辑,确保了系统的稳定运行和用户体验。UML模型的应用使得系统设计和实现更加规范和易于理解,为系统的扩展和维护提供了清晰的蓝图。